Near-infrared-II carbon dots offer exceptional deep-tissue penetration for biomedical imaging, but challenges remain in their synthesis and photoluminescence mechanisms. In this work, the authors designed and synthesized a series of carbon dots (CDs-1 to CDs-3) through extension of aniline-based frameworks, achieving tunable emission extending into the NIR-II region, and applied these CDs in deeptissue NIR-II imaging of the hepatobiliary system.
